技术领域 technical field
本实用新型涉及医疗器械领域,具体涉及一种尤其适用于危重卧病在床患者的大便失禁引流装置。 The utility model relates to the field of medical equipment, in particular to a fecal incontinence drainage device especially suitable for critically ill bedridden patients.
背景技术 Background technique
对于大便失禁的患者来说,尤其是危重卧病在床的大便失禁患者,最大的问题就是排大便,协助病人排便不仅给病人家属或医护人员带来麻烦,还会给患者本人带来很大痛苦。在病人排便时,人们常规的做法都是将便盆放于病人臀部下方来接取大便,但这种做法在实际应用过程中存在以下缺陷:1、对于大便失禁患者来说,由于其排便不能自控,随时都有可能大便,容易污染床被,并增大了护理人员的负担;2、病人在排便时,大便的臭味易四周扩散污染室内空气,会造成医护人员、病人家属或临床病人的恶心、呕吐等不良反应;3、病人排便后,由于大便的刺激,再加上擦拭对皮肤的摩擦,容易导致病人肛门处的皮肤烂掉。 For patients with fecal incontinence, especially critically ill patients with fecal incontinence who are bedridden, the biggest problem is defecation. Assisting patients to defecate will not only bring trouble to the patient's family members or medical staff, but also bring great pain to the patient himself. . When the patient defecates, people's conventional practice is to put the bedpan under the patient's buttocks to receive the stool, but this method has the following defects in the actual application process: 1. For patients with fecal incontinence, because their defecation cannot be controlled , it is possible to defecate at any time, which is easy to pollute the bed and quilt, and increases the burden on the nursing staff; 2. When the patient defecates, the odor of the stool is easy to spread around and pollute the indoor air, which will cause medical staff, patients' family members or clinical patients. Nausea, vomiting and other adverse reactions; 3. After the patient defecates, the skin at the anus of the patient is likely to rot due to the stimulation of the stool and the friction of wiping the skin.

实施例1: Example 1:
如图1所示,本实用新型大便失禁引流装置,包括用于收集大便的集便袋1和用于贴在患者肛门周围皮肤上的粘贴盘2,粘贴盘2与集便袋1连接且设有与集便袋1内腔连通的通孔21,粘贴盘2与集便袋1连接后类似于现有医疗用的造口袋,集便袋1连接有用于将大便导出的大便导出管3,大便导出管3可采用现有医疗用的一次性使用的连接导管。使用时,将粘贴盘2贴在患者肛门周围的皮肤上即可,患者排出的大便直接进入集便袋1,再由大便导出管3排到指定的地方,例如,连接到医院用于吸痰用的负压吸引瓶,可以更加方便的将大便吸出。此外,在使用前还可以在患者肛门周围的皮肤上先涂上皮肤保护膜,起到隔离大便与皮肤的作用,避免皮肤坏掉,同时也便于将粘贴盘2贴合到肛门处。该大便失禁引流装置解决了危重卧病在床的大便失禁患者排便不方便、护理麻烦等问题,具有结构简单、成本低廉、使用方便卫生、使用舒适可靠、可大大减小大便失禁患者护理难度等优点。 As shown in Figure 1, the fecal incontinence drainage device of the present utility model comprises a feces collection bag 1 for collecting stool and an adhesive disc 2 for sticking on the skin around the patient's anus, the adhesive disc 2 is connected with the feces collection bag 1 and set There is a through hole 21 communicating with the inner cavity of the stool collection bag 1. After the pasting plate 2 is connected with the stool collection bag 1, it is similar to an existing medical ostomy bag. Stool outlet tube 3 can adopt the disposable connecting catheter of existing medical use. When in use, just paste the paste plate 2 on the skin around the patient's anus, and the stool discharged by the patient directly enters the stool bag 1, and then is discharged to a designated place by the stool outlet tube 3, for example, connected to the hospital for sputum suction The negative pressure suction bottle used can suck out the stool more conveniently. In addition, before use, a skin protection film can be applied on the skin around the patient's anus to isolate the stool from the skin and prevent the skin from being damaged, and it is also convenient to attach the paste plate 2 to the anus. The fecal incontinence drainage device solves the problems of inconvenient defecation and troublesome nursing care for critically ill patients with fecal incontinence, and has the advantages of simple structure, low cost, convenient and hygienic use, comfortable and reliable use, and can greatly reduce the difficulty of nursing for fecal incontinence patients. .
本实施例中,大便导出管3与集便袋1连于一体,集便袋1与大便导出管3的连接处呈漏斗形,便于大便进入大便导出管3排出。在其他实施例中,大便导出管3与集便袋1也可以是活动连接,例如,插接或螺纹连接。 In this embodiment, the stool outlet tube 3 is connected with the stool collection bag 1, and the connection between the stool collection bag 1 and the stool outlet tube 3 is funnel-shaped, so that the stool can enter the stool outlet tube 3 and be discharged. In other embodiments, the stool outlet tube 3 and the stool bag 1 can also be flexibly connected, for example, plugged or threaded.
本实施例中,大便导出管3上设有第二通断控制阀6,可以根据需要控制大便导出管3的通断,以决定是否将大便排出。 In this embodiment, the stool outlet pipe 3 is provided with a second on-off control valve 6, which can control the on-off of the stool outlet pipe 3 to determine whether to discharge the stool.
本实施例中,集便袋1连接有用于向集便袋1内注水的进水管4,进水管4连接在集便袋1漏斗形部分的底部,与大便导出管3并排设置,进水管4上设有第一通断控制阀5,便于向集便袋1内注水进行清洗,当患者排出的大便过于黏稠而无法通过大便导出管3排出时,也可通过向集便袋1内注水进行稀释。进水管4的出口位于集便袋1内远离大便导出管3进口的位置处,注水时,水直接注入到集便袋1最里面,从而使清洗效果和稀释效果更好,最好是将进水管4的出口设在粘贴盘2的通孔21处,起到清洗患者肛门的作用。进水管4位于集便袋1内的部分与集便袋1连接在一起,这样,进水管4不会乱窜,舒适度更好,且能避免破坏集便袋1。进水管4位于集便袋1外的部分与大便导出管3连接在一起,便于将进水管4和大便导出管3一同引出,不易被患者身体压迫到。 In this embodiment, the stool collection bag 1 is connected with a water inlet pipe 4 for injecting water into the stool collection bag 1. The water inlet pipe 4 is connected to the bottom of the funnel-shaped part of the stool collection bag 1, and is arranged side by side with the stool outlet pipe 3. The water inlet pipe 4 There is a first on-off control valve 5 on the top, which is convenient to inject water into the stool collection bag 1 for cleaning. When the stool discharged by the patient is too viscous to be discharged through the stool outlet tube 3, it can also be cleaned by injecting water into the stool collection bag 1. dilution. The outlet of the water inlet pipe 4 is located in the stool collection bag 1 away from the entrance of the stool outlet pipe 3. When filling water, the water is directly injected into the innermost side of the stool collection bag 1, so that the cleaning effect and dilution effect are better. The outlet of the water pipe 4 is located at the through hole 21 of the paste plate 2, which plays the role of cleaning the patient's anus. The part of the water inlet pipe 4 located in the stool collection bag 1 is connected with the stool collection bag 1, so that the water inlet pipe 4 will not run around, the comfort is better, and the damage to the stool collection bag 1 can be avoided. The part of the water inlet pipe 4 located outside the stool bag 1 is connected with the stool outlet pipe 3, so that the water inlet pipe 4 and the stool outlet pipe 3 can be drawn out together, and it is not easy to be oppressed by the patient's body.
上述第一通断控制阀5和第二通断控制阀6采用医用的两通阀。在其他实施例中,也可以采用结构更加简单的通过卡紧变形来阻断软管的弹性卡,该弹性卡可以直接卡在大便导出管3或进水管4的外部,并迫使大便导出管3或进水管4变形从而阻断其内部通道。还可采用其他能够控制大便导出管3和进水管4通断的组件。 The first on-off control valve 5 and the second on-off control valve 6 are medical two-way valves. In other embodiments, an elastic card with a simpler structure that blocks the hose by clamping and deforming can also be used. The elastic card can be directly stuck on the outside of the stool outlet tube 3 or the water inlet tube 4, and force the stool outlet tube 3 Or the water inlet pipe 4 is deformed so as to block its internal passage. Other components that can control the on-off of the stool outlet pipe 3 and the water inlet pipe 4 can also be used.
实施例2: Example 2:
如图2所示,本实施例与实施例1基本相同,不同的是,本实施例的大便失禁引流装置中第一通断控制阀5的阀芯与第二通断控制阀6的阀芯连接为一体并设在同一阀体内,即第一通断控制阀5和第二通断控制阀6制作成一体,这样阀芯可由一个控制开关控制,例如可以是一个四通阀的结构。同时,进水管4套设在大便导出管3的内部,使结构更加简单紧凑,制作成本更低。 As shown in Figure 2, this embodiment is basically the same as Embodiment 1, the difference is that the spool of the first on-off control valve 5 and the spool of the second on-off control valve 6 in the fecal incontinence drainage device of this embodiment Connected as a whole and set in the same valve body, that is, the first on-off control valve 5 and the second on-off control valve 6 are made into one, so that the valve core can be controlled by a control switch, for example, it can be a four-way valve structure. At the same time, the water inlet pipe 4 is sleeved inside the stool outlet pipe 3, so that the structure is simpler and more compact, and the manufacturing cost is lower.
